Handyman assistance for seniors is centered on home modifications that support independent living. This might involve installing motion-sensor lighting, lever-style door handles, or shower seats. These professional adjustments help maintain a safe environment as needs change over time.

Be wary of handymen who can't provide references, don't offer a written estimate, or demand a large upfront payment. If they seem hesitant to discuss the scope of work or lack necessary insurance, that's also a concern. Always look for clear communication and professionalism.
